Senior Police Inspector Arun Borude, who has been accused of raping a 15-year-old girl in suburban Powai in Mumbai, has been dismissed from service, the police said on Wednesday. Borude has been absconding since the case was registered last week. "The state director general of police ordered Borude's dismissal under Article 311 of the Constitution on grounds of immoral conduct," City Police Commissioner Sanjeev Dayal told reporters.

Two persons, including a security guard, were killed and as many injured in an exchange of fire between two rival gangs in a hospital in Rohtak district in Haryana, police said on Thursday. Praveen, 35, a member of one of the two gangs who was undergoing treatment at the Pandit Bhagwat Dayal Sharma Post Graduate Institute of Medical Sciences in Rohtak, died in the shooting incident along with the guard, Tejveer, Rohtak's Superintendent of Police B Satish Balan said.
